- The distance between Isoka, Zambia and Kahului, Maui, Hawaii is approximately 18,473 km or 11,479 mi.
- To reach Isoka in this distance one would set out from Kahului, Maui bearing 319.7° or NW and follow the great circles arc to approach Isoka bearing 217.9° or SW .
- Isoka has a humid subtropical climate with dry winters (Cwa) whereas Kahului, Maui has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ry summers (As).
- Both are in or near the subtropical dry forest biome.
- The annual mean temperature is 4.2 °C (7.6°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 2.1 °C (3.8°F) more in Isoka. The continentality subtype is truly hyperoceanic for both.
- Total annual precipitation averages 558.5 mm (22 in) more which is equivalent to 558.5 l/m² (13.71 US gal/ft²) or 5,585,000 l/ha (597,074 US gal/ac) more. About 2 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 4.3° higher in Isoka than in Kahului, Maui.
